Drug smuggling is a serious profession which is rampant all over the world. Despite the government’s attempt to tackle this problem, this black market is growing and getting more organized. While the law enforcing agencies are coming up with more brilliant and innovative ways to make more drug arrests, drug smugglers or mules, as they are called, are also using Presently innovative techniques to transport drugs across states and countries.
Most Drug arrests happen in airports. Police use sniffer dogs, x-ray machines for the baggage as well as body x-rays, scanners, and other hi-tech devices to trace any drug which a carrier may have ingeniously concealed anywhere in his body or baggage. Penalty for drug smuggling is very severe, ranging from 5 years to 40 years or even imprisonment for life. Hair Transplant Surgery has a new Bestfriend
A hair transplant operation is a process that makes use of the patient’s hair by transplanting it from one part to another part of the head. This operation involves the transfer of around 1500 grafts, each containing one to four follicles of hair to the treated area. These grafts are first obtained from a donor strip at the back of the patient’s head. This strip measures 9mm and 12mm wide, and the length varies from 75mm or more, depending on how many grafts are required. The donor strip is slivered to create micrografts of 1-2 hairs, or minigrafts of 3-4 hairs. Once this strip is removed, the scar is closed and becomes unnoticeable.
